Taser Parties Now Hotter Than Mary Kay or Tupperware Parties

They're just like any other shopping-focused get-together, except in this case, instead of kitchen gadgets and overpriced makeup, party guests examine non-lethal self-defense weaponry. They're invited to check out a selection of tasers (including a pink model), pick out a model that fits in their purses the best, and, if we're interpreting the video at the Read link below correctly, even taser husbands to get a feel for how the thing operates.
Now that sounds like much more of a party than exchanging muffin recipes and buying expensive whisks. [Source: CNN]
